Ranks
Live
Leaderboard
Heroes
Items
Login
Ranked badges are now live!
Read the Changelog - How Accurate Is Tracklock?
Observed Matches
(EU)
ID
Hero
Date
Region
Match Average Rank
Valve Match Rating
24066694
Yamato
Oct 21, 2024
EU
SEEKER VI
1000
24060460
Warden
Oct 21, 2024
EU
EMISSARY II
1109
23420979
Wraith
Oct 18, 2024
EU
OBSCURUS
1003
23411618
Vindicta
Oct 18, 2024
EU
ALCHEMIST IV
1148
23401819
Seven
Oct 18, 2024
EU
INITIATE III
1105
23400510
Seven
Oct 18, 2024
EU
ARCHON II
1126
23026339
Yamato
Oct 16, 2024
EU
OBSCURUS
1093
Previous
1
Next